Only three buckles, and they appear to be plastic. They seem to be an entry level boot as previously stated. You can find better boots, but they are better than no boots at all.

Here are a few features to look for in a "good quality" boot;

-Four buckles made of aluminum that are replaceable.
-Heat sheild on the inner calf. (leather or rubber for grip)
-Padding around ankle and foot.
-Good comfy insole. (with arch support)
